Model and author Emily Ratajkowski stopped by Vogue’s Forces of Fashion to talk all things wellness, the modeling industry and motherhood before a crowd of fashion insiders and fans. Emily also deep dives on her life after divorce, her feelings about “Blurred Lines” 10 years later, and the lasting effects of being one of the most photographed women in the world.
